Enhancing Player Experience with Low-Latency Streaming
I've streamed live blackjack from servers in three different continents. The difference is stark. A 200ms delay makes betting feel disconnected; a 50ms stream feels like you're at the table. Modern infrastructure now uses edge computing to push processing closer to the user.
The fastest betting interface in the world is useless if the live dealer video lags. Speed isn't a feature; it's the entire product.

Optimizing Betting Platforms and User Interface Design
Betting isn't shopping. The interface must guide action under pressure. I tested five major platforms for bet placement speed.
- Display live odds directly on the main game screen, no pop-ups.
- One-click bet slip for pre-set amounts like $10, $25, $50.
- Persistent bet slip that follows scrolling.
- Visual and audio confirmation for every placed bet.
- Cash-out button must be within the primary viewport, always.
Clunky navigation loses money. My tests showed a well-designed UI can increase bets per session by an average of 1.8. That's a direct revenue multiplier.

The Future of Gaming: Microservices and Cloud Infrastructure
Monolithic platforms can't scale. I've migrated two legacy systems to a microservices architecture. The result was a 70% reduction in feature deployment time. Each game, each payment method, each loyalty module becomes its own independently scalable service.
